Communal Cremation for Pets in Reno: A Cost-Effective Choice

Dealing with an demise of a beloved animal, particularly within this city, can be emotionally difficult. Many pet owners are seeking budget-friendly options for saying goodbye, and communal cremation offers a truly cost-effective choice. This option involves your companion's remains being respectfully cremated alongside other animals, with the ashes not returned to you. Instead of expensive individual cremation fees, communal services provide a more accessible and compassionate way to honor your cherished companion. It's a practical decision for families seeking closure without the burden of higher fees. Think about communal cremation as a supportive and dignified way to navigate this difficult time.

Choosing a Reno Pet Cremation Service: What to Consider

Losing a special pet is deeply painful experience, and deciding what to do with their remains can be overwhelming. When choosing a Reno pet cremation service , there are quite a few important factors to consider . First, look at their track record ; read feedback and ask for recommendations from your veterinarian . Next, know the different types of cremation offered - private versus shared – and what they entail . Finally, be sure to discuss their pricing structure and the keepsake choices available. This will help you find a compassionate service that fulfills your requirements .

Understanding Reno Pet Cremation Costs and Services

Dealing with a of a beloved pet is incredibly heartbreaking, and planning their final arrangements can add another layer of stress. In Reno, Nevada, several options exist for companion animal cremation, each with varying costs and options. Generally, you'll find a couple of main types: individual (or private) cremation, where your pet is cremated alone, and communal cremation, where multiple pets are cremated concurrently. Individual cremation typically carries a higher expense due to the extra care involved. Typical prices for individual pet cremation in Reno can range from $approximately $300 to $700, depending on your animal’s size and included services. Communal cremation is usually more affordable, with prices often falling between $a $150 and $350. Outside of the base cremation cost, you may also encounter charges for extra services such as pickup of your pet’s body, a memorial urn, or shipping of the ashes. It's important to closely research and compare different Reno pet cremation providers to understand exactly what is included in the pricing and ensure that they offer the level of compassion you desire during this sensitive time.

Sole vs. Group Cremation: The Reno Area 's Pet Farewell Alternatives

When dealing with the difficult decision of saying goodbye to your beloved furry friend , exploring cremation options in Reno is important. You can typically select between a private cremation and a communal one. A individual cremation involves your companion's remains being cremated only with their own, allowing you to receive the ashes back in an urn or other keepsake container; this offers a more personalized and intimate farewell. Alternatively, a communal cremation involves multiple animals being cremated together, with the ashes being scattered respectfully at a designated memorial location – often a more budget-friendly choice.
